Amazon.com Takes On Digital Book Printers

-- Graphic Arts Online, 3/27/2008 3:50:00 PM

Amazon.com delivered a blow to on-demand book printers as it has notified publishers who print books on demand they must use its printing facilities if they want their books sold directly on the online giant’s website.

News of Amazon's new policy was posted on several Websites on yesterday and reported in today’s Wall Street Journal.

Amazon offers POD book printing through its BookSurge unit, which it acquired in 2005. The company brought color book printing in-house in 2006, when it installed multiple HP Indigo digital presses at its fulfillment centers. (e-GAM 12/4/06)  Amazon recently acquired audio book seller Audible Inc. Amazon also sells its own e-book reader called the Kindle (e-GAM 12/1/07). Amazon is one of the biggest booksellers in the U.S., with a market share publishing experts estimate to be about 15%.
